Output 620686603a29499d94e97fbba4982d48aefc25524de82e089c29622964bf68c8:1

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 210bf95d9e74b7d1162cdd80a5afcc482e105459
address
tb1qyy9ljhv7wjmaz93vmkq2tt7vfqhpq4ze8pm59s
transaction
620686603a29499d94e97fbba4982d48aefc25524de82e089c29622964bf68c8
confirmations
54388
spent
true